如何在asp.net雷达图中更改x轴标签的方向?

时间:2014-02-19 12:20:13

标签: asp.net charts label orientation radar-chart

我的网页上有4张雷达图表。 四个图表中的三个具有水平定向的x轴标签。 其中一个图表的标签朝向图表的中心。

所有图表都以相同的方式动态创建。我相信它正在发生,因为一张图表有很多分数。

请参阅下图。 enter image description here

我有以下代码设置Xaxis的方向,但这不起作用。

ca.AxisX.TextOrientation = TextOrientation.Horizontal;

到目前为止我尝试的代码没有用。我插入以下代码以查看是否可以更改任何轴的方向,它会更改y轴的方向而不是x轴。

foreach (Axis axis in chartArea.Axes)
            {
                axis.LabelAutoFitStyle = LabelAutoFitStyles.None;
                axis.LabelAutoFitMaxFontSize = 50;
                axis.IsLabelAutoFit = false;
                axis.LabelStyle.Angle = 90;
                aaxisTextOrientation = TextOrientation.Horizontal;

            }

如何使所有图表的x轴标签水平定向?

1 个答案:

答案 0 :(得分:0)

回答我自己的问题,以防将来对其他人有用:

chart.Series[series1]["CircularLabelsStyle"] = "Horizontal";

其他选项包括RadialCircular

有关自定义属性的详细信息,请参阅以下链接。 link